			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><a href="http://www.mavericksaloon.org/wp-content/uploads/2011/11/The-Maverick-Saloon-Santa-Ynez.jpg" rel="lightbox[709]"><img src="http://www.mavericksaloon.org/wp-content/uploads/2011/11/The-Maverick-Saloon-Santa-Ynez.jpg" alt="" title="The-Maverick-Saloon-Santa-Ynez" width="253" height="199" class="alignleft size-full wp-image-710" /></a>Santa Ynez is a sleepy little town of four and half thousand souls in the eponymous Santa Ynez Valley, the heart of the Santa Barbara Wine Country. You can of course taste some great wines at the many nice restaurants in Santa Ynez, but there are good reasons to visit the historic, western town:<br />
As mentioned above, Santa Ynez has lots of great places to take a break from your wine tour and grab a bite to eat. The Red Barn is a real down to earth steakhouse where they still put a bib around your neck if you order ribs. If you want some good Mexican food, there are a couple of options: Carlito’s, which has their main restaurant on State St. in Santa Barbara, has authentic Mexican dishes and a wide selection of Tequilas, or if you just want to grab a quick burrito, try SY burrito, Santa Ynez’ version of Chipotle. Grappolo serves tasty Italian fare, The Vineyard House offers fine wine country cuisine, and for breakfast, you should hit the Longhorn – they have fantastic omelets.<br />
The Maverick Saloon, the most popular destination for visitors to this western-style town complete with building facades that make it look like a set for an old Clint Eastwood movie,  is a real country bar and a Santa Ynez landmark.<br />
Santa Ynez is home to the Chumash Indian Tribe’s casino, appropriately named the Chumash Casino Resort.<br />
The Santa Ynez Historical Museum has interesting artifacts both from the town’s history as an old stagecoach stop and from the Chumash tribe.<br />

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><a href="http://www.mavericksaloon.org/wp-content/uploads/2011/11/kels-wines_15.jpg" rel="lightbox[699]"><img src="http://www.mavericksaloon.org/wp-content/uploads/2011/11/kels-wines_15-300x199.jpg" alt="" title="kels wines_15" width="300" height="199" class="alignleft size-medium wp-image-700" /></a>SANTA YNEZ VALLEY &#8211; The Maverick Saloon in Santa Ynez has debuted first ever, customized wines themed like the &#8216;Wild Wild West&#8217;, only sold at the restaurant&#8217;s locations.</p>
<p>The wines were first presented last Thursday at actor Jack Bridges&#8217; band&#8217;s performance at the restaurant.</p>
<p>A 2008 Santa Barbara Chardonnay and Syrah are now available for purchase.</p>
<p>The wines are made by Brian Freeborn, well known for making another custom wine for Fleetwood Mac called &#8216;Mic Fleetwood&#8217;. </p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><a href="http://www.mavericksaloon.org/wp-content/uploads/2011/11/maverick1.jpg" rel="lightbox[692]"><img src="http://www.mavericksaloon.org/wp-content/uploads/2011/11/maverick1-300x300.jpg" alt="" title="maverick1" width="300" height="300" class="alignleft size-medium wp-image-693" /></a>A step out of the Wild West, this is about as close as you can get to a saloon from the 1800&#8242;s. It sports a piano that is wildly out of tune (for the honky tonk effect), but has frequent concerts of the best C &#038; W west of (and including) Nashville, TN. (Don&#8217;t forget to pin your $ with your card to the ceiling &#8211; a Valley tradition.) 			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><a href="http://www.mavericksaloon.org/wp-content/uploads/2011/11/maverick_logo.gif" rel="lightbox[666]"><img src="http://www.mavericksaloon.org/wp-content/uploads/2011/11/maverick_logo.gif" alt="" title="maverick_logo" width="224" height="200" class="alignleft size-full wp-image-667" /></a>The Maverick Saloon Project, an ongoing series of live performance images shot at the Maverick Saloon in Santa Ynez, and the Maverick Saloon &#038; Grill in Santa Maria, California, is the natural outgrowth of a very successful effort to provide website images reflecting the extraordinary level of Country Music talent that has come to these two Central Coast venues. The Project started as a suggestion by Donny Schreck, a local guitarist for Mesa Creek &#038; Roughstock who has been on the Country Music scene here for many years. Donny, who had done some previous work with Dwight, introduced him to Mark &#038; Travis Burnett, the owners of the Maverick Saloon in Santa Ynez. The Burnetts, having established themselves as first rate bar owners felt that having high quality images of their talent imports on the Maverick Saloon website would be good PR.</p>
<p>Dwight&#8217;s first performance shoot was of Rhonda Vincent, a national Bluegrass star, and her band, The Rage, on July 31, 2003. Rhonda had previously been in the area that Spring at the Live Oak Music Festival where Dwight first saw her. Pictures from this show were well received and soon thereafter images of Pat Green, Paul Thorn, Dierks Bentley, Jennifer Hanson, Confederate Railroad, Craig Morgan, Aaron Lines and Billy Currington followed. The images were overflowing on the Maverick website.</p>
<p>At this point, a second Maverick, the Maverick Saloon &#038; Grill, came into being in Santa Maria, California. It was not until this point that Dwight finally met up with the powerhouse who had been working with Nashville to bring all this talent to our little valley, Rick Barker. Rick does more by accident than most people do on purpose: he is the Program Director at the local Country station, KRAZ, manages the talent at both Mavericks, has started the &#8220;Nashville To You&#8221; West Coast Acoustic Tour, has his hands into most everything, and is a devoted husband and father. Dwight now shoots at both Maverick locations and has added Josh Turner, the Bellamy Brothers, Brian McComas, Blackhawk and Memarie to his portfolio. And now Chely Wright, Scotty Emerick (where some of Dwight&#8217;s photographs are on display) and the incomparable Sugarland [Dwight's personal favorite ... he's already worn out one CD!] Phew! Pat Green was back and is in the Project again.</p>
<p>In a slightly different vein, Cledus T. Judd was at the Maverick with folks rolling on the floor laughing &#8230; not all images from that performance can be shown on this family project!</p>
<p>Julie Roberts arrived recently in a horse drawn carriage at the Maverick, but it was too dark for decent pictures. Sugarland made two more appearances, thank you very much &#8230; again, my favorite group. A very loud but very good Cross Canadian Ragweed was a very different flavor of show. As as the final show in October, 2004, a very big month for the Maverick, Jamie O&#8217;Neal (supported by husband Rod and a &#8220;melt my heart&#8221; Megan Mullins) put on two shows with Christy Sutherland opening for her &#8230; absolutely first rate acts &#8230; I was listening to Jamie on her website (at the moment that&#8217;s the ONLY choice!) while adding this update.</p>
